Role Overview:
We are seeking a skilled Technical LV Electrician with strong industrial experience to join a growing engineering team in Derby. This role will involve working across a range of industrial electrical systems, carrying out installation, maintenance, fault finding, and supporting critical operations.
You will play a key role in ensuring reliability and performance of electrical systems, with participation in an on-call rota to support reactive maintenance and emergency response.
Key Responsibilities:
Carry out installation, maintenance, and fault finding on LV electrical systems Work on industrial equipment, control panels, and distribution systems Diagnose and resolve electrical faults efficiently to minimise downtime Support commissioning and upgrade works where required Read and interpret electrical drawings and schematics Ensure all work is completed in line with health & safety standards Participate in an on-call rota for out-of-hours support Key Requirements:
Proven experience as an LV Electrician within an industrial environment HV Knowledge a preference but not essential - a willingness to learn is very much needed Strong fault-finding and diagnostic skills Experience with control panels, motors, and distribution systems Ability to read and interpret electrical schematics Knowledge of relevant electrical standards and regulations (e.g. BS7671) Full UK driving licence Willingness to participate in on-call rota
Travel, Hours & Call-Out
Working away is required, with all expenses fully covered. Standard working hours: 8 hours per day at standard rate, with time-and-a-half paid thereafter. The company provides a 24/7 call-out service The successful candidate will not be placed on the call-out rota until they are fully inducted. Discretionary call-out payments to be confirmed.
